Output b05fc25bd23b074c7ecb5df81e0e238d50c3b2d61c612d1fa0ed54e18b0fa43f:0

value
943498
script pubkey
OP_0 OP_PUSHBYTES_20 8aab86d0cbe0ca779b4c04b515c5d99212ed6bc4
address
tb1q324cd5xtur980x6vqj63t3wejgfw667y3lvhkp
transaction
b05fc25bd23b074c7ecb5df81e0e238d50c3b2d61c612d1fa0ed54e18b0fa43f
confirmations
96749
spent
true